Step-by-Step Timeline for Planning

8 Weeks Out: Define Objectives

  • Identify what you want to achieve (e.g., improve communication, foster collaboration).
  • Discuss with leadership to align on goals.

6 Weeks Out: Choose Activities

  • Select 2-3 activities suitable for remote settings.
  • Consider the interests and preferences of your team.

4 Weeks Out: Send Invitations

  • Use calendar invites to schedule the session.
  • Include a brief agenda to set expectations.

2 Weeks Out: Prepare Materials

  • If using props or digital tools, ensure all materials are ready.
  • Test technology platforms (Zoom, Microsoft Teams, etc.).

1 Week Out: Final Checks

  • Confirm attendance and send reminders.
  • Ensure all participants have access to necessary tools.

Activity Ideas for Remote Teams

1. Virtual Scavenger Hunt

  • Time Needed: 30 minutes
  • Group Size: 5-10 participants
  • Cost: Free if self-facilitated; $100 for a hosted option
  • Energy Level: High
  • Logistical Notes: Participants gather items from their home that fit specific prompts.
  • "Skip if...": The team has a significant number of introverts who may be uncomfortable sharing personal items.

2. Two Truths and a Lie

  • Time Needed: 30 minutes
  • Group Size: 5-20 participants
  • Cost: Free
  • Energy Level: Medium
  • Logistical Notes: Each participant shares two truths and one lie; others guess the lie.
  • "Skip if...": The team is new and lacks familiarity with one another.

3. Quick Team Quiz

  • Time Needed: 30 minutes
  • Group Size: Up to 50 participants
  • Cost: $50 for quiz tools
  • Energy Level: Medium
  • Logistical Notes: Use platforms like Kahoot! to create a fun quiz about team members or company trivia.
  • "Skip if...": The team prefers more interactive activities over quizzes.

Risk Mitigation: What Could Go Wrong?

  • Technical Issues: Ensure all participants have the necessary software installed. Conduct a tech check before the session.
  • Low Engagement: Prepare icebreakers to kick off the session and encourage participation.
  • Time Management: Assign a timekeeper to keep the session on track.
